Certificate Expiry Leads to Total Outage For Microsoft Azure Secured Storage 176
rtfa-troll writes "There has been a worldwide (all locations) total outage of storage in Microsoft's Azure cloud. Apparently, 'Microsoft unwittingly let an online security certificate expire Friday, triggering a worldwide outage in an online service that stores data for a wide range of business customers,' according to the San Francisco Chronicle (also Yahoo and the Register). Perhaps too much time has been spent sucking up to storage vendors and not enough looking after the customers? This comes directly after a week-long outage of one of Microsoft's SQL server components in Azure. This is not the first time that we have discussed major outages on Azure and probably won't be the last. It's certainly also not the first time we have discussed Microsoft cloud systems making users' data unavailable."

Re:Somebody (Score:5, Insightful)
Right and I think this is an important aspect to the problem here.
There is simply no substitute for having all your I's dotted and T's cross with large integrated systems like this. This is a culture problem not a individual screwed up problem. If you just fire the guy, there will be lots of awareness but the take away most of your remaining people will get is "don't forget to check the certificate expiry dates, that'll get you canned" many of them traumatized by the experience will dutifully check certificate dates for the rest of their careers but this will do nothing to prevent your next major outage; because that will almost certainly be the result of something else.
Everyone is pushing this vitalization + "dev ops" + management/monitoring is going to let us have one admin do what was once the work of ten. The fact is it just does not work like that. Management/monitoring like Microsoft Mom for example requires you to have all the failure modes identified and the scripts written to check conditions like expiry dates and trigger the alerts. Unless everyone is really good about all the routine maintenance tasks in there is won't help with something like this. That takes time you ONE admin has not got and discipline that breaks down when someone is overworked.
The "dev ops" and vitalization stuff is all great in terms of how much can be automated. Someone has to develop that automation though. Your ONE guy does not have time to build and test his generic deployment scrip when you promised your customers you'd have their infrastructure stood up last week.
It comes down to the business recognizing its important to have good people, enough people, and willingness to invest in making sure the job is done correctly and completely every time, and that documentation is maintained and in a way everyone knows how to use it. Check lists need to be kept and followed etc. IT got away from plant engineering style discipline when hardware got cheap. You know longer had to worry about that one computer you had failing. As we move back to more consolidated and integrated solutions; management is going to have to get used to the idea again that there is some people time investment that must be made. Its great you can save on power, cooling equipment, and headcount but you can't cut headcount to far because the more consolidated you get the less you can afford for anything to go wrong so it all must be check, doubled checked, and checked again just to be sure. This is if you do it yourself or if you pay your cloud provider to do it. Either way cloud services so far have been mostly a race to the bottom and that is going to cause some to have to learn some very painful lessons if the industry remains on its current trajectory.

You'd think that, but there's contract stuff. The thing is, you basically need a department in charge of renewing shit like this when you have enterprise level services. We've got a site with millions of hits daily and still manage to let it expire every couple of years. You try the credit card thing, but credit cards expire. You try recurring billing and then you get into a contractual nightmare with the registrar. The registrar isn't going to do you any favors, you might get millions of hits daily, but they still only get $5/year even from google.com so fuck you, figure out the billing yourself.
The only real way to do it effectively is build yourself a database of all the crap you need to renew regularly, then hire someone to renew that stuff. But who are you going to hire? It usually ends up being some assistant that doesn't know a damned thing about tech... and it's still going to cost you $60k a year in pay and bennifits to retain them. That's an expensive way of keeping track of such things... ah, the website admins can remember right?

Re:Tip of the iceberg (Score:5, Insightful)
The reality is, if you outsource your hosting to a single company, there will always be single points of failure.
There will be architectural ones, like root of trust expiring resulting in security framework taking everything down.
There will be bugs that can bite all of their instances in the same way at the same time.
There will be business realities like failing to pay electric bills, or collapsing, or simply closing down their hosting business for the sake of other business interests.
Ideally:
-You must keep ownership of all data required to set up anywhere at all time. Even if you host nothing publicly yourself, you must assure all your data exists on storage that you own.
-You either do not outsource your hosting (in which case your single point of failure business wise would take you out anyway) or else you outsource to financially independent companies. "Everything to EC2" is a huge mistake, just as much as "everything to azure" is a huge mistake.
-Never trust a providers security promises beyond what they explicitly accept liability for. If you consider the potential risk to be "priceless", then you cannot host it. If you do know what your exposure is (e.g. you could be sued for 20 million, then only host it if the provider will assume liability to the tune of 20 million)

Re:When you depend on other people ... (Score:4, Interesting)
Actually, there's a bit more to being "cloudy" than just virtual servers over the internet (indeed, they not even need be over the internet - you can have your own local cloud and many companies have internal clouds). Virtual servers over the internet is merely client/server. For a service to be "cloudy", generally it'll have attributes like HTTP (in other words, RESTful interfaces and each request being treated no different to the first request, in other words, the service doesn't hold state from request to request, just like with HTTP) and distributable. The main benefit of "cloudiness" is because of this you can easy scale up services when demand is high, and scale them back when demand is low. It makes it easier to make a resilient service than the traditional client/server type service where the server side has to keep state. Infrastructures like Amazon's EC2 allow you to scale things up and down easily and economically because you can turn on the "virtual server over the internet" part of it on and off very rapidly, and you only pay for the instances you've instatiated. But just using Amazon's EC2 doesn't automatically make your service "cloudy" if it does not have all the other necessary attributes.

Simple operation? You've clearly never worked for a large company.
Even if a warning wasn't trickled down a month ago, and we've no reason to assume it wasn't, the person whose job it is to act on it, provided they weren't on vacation, won't have simply thrown five dollars at a registrar. They'll have had to put in a request to the finance department, probably via a cost-management chain of command, with a full description of what needed to be paid to whom and why, with payee reference, cost-center code, expense code and departmental authorization, and hoped it would arrive in time to be allocated to the next monthly rubber-stamp meeting. Assuming the application contained no errors, was suitably endorsed and was made against an allocated budget that hadn't been over-spent and wasn't under review, then, perhaps, in the fullness of time, it might have received approval and have been sent back down the chain for subsequent escalation to the bought-ledger department, who'd have looked at the due date, added ninety days and put it on the bottom of the pile. After those ninety days, when the finance folk began to take a view to assessing its urgency, unless they found a proper purchase order from the supplier, and a full set of signed terms and conditions of purchase, non-disclosure agreements, sustainability declarations and ethical supply-chain statements, as now required by any self-respecting outfit, it'll have been put aside and, eventually, sent back round to be done properly. Or, if it all checked out first time, it'll have been put on the system for calendering into the next round of payment processing.
I'm sure it might be possible to streamline aspects of such mechanisms, but to suggest there's anything trivial about them is a touch hasty. But you never know. Re: (Score:2)
Because they are forbidden to issue a certificate with a greater validity than 39 months in accordance with the CA/Browser Forum Baseline Requirements for Publicly Trusted Certificates [cabforum.org] (warning: PDF). If they were to violate this, they'd have GTE's root certificate de-listed by Apple, Google, Mozilla, KDE, Opera, Blackberry and ... um ... Microsoft. Which would invalidate their subordinate certificate.
